Your life doesnât have to be in shambles to need a reset.
In fact, regularly checking in with yourself and making sure youâre on the right track or doing a little course correction if necessary is essential for living the life you love.
In this workshop, author and illustrator Justin Shiels shares the life-changing year that led to his first reset and the 7 steps he took to reconnect with his passion, purpose, and vision. Follow his journey and learn practical tips to make tiny optimizations in your daily life. Building a life you love isnât easy, but itâs well worth the work.
Justin Shiels is an award-winning creative director, author, and illustrator. Heâs the founder of SoCurious.co, a platform that inspires creative people to find small, but meaningful breakthroughs in personal growth, productivity, and creativity through short form content and IRL products.
His upcoming title, The Reset Workbook is scheduled to debut on December 6, 2023, with Spruce Books, an imprint of Penguin Random House.

The FieldTrips experience is defined not only by what the host has to share, but also by how we show up individually and collectively. The way we show up impacts our capacity to be moved, inspired, and activated.
Get ready to be immersed! Engage with smiles, nods, waves, emojis. Share in the chat. Get cozy. Turn off notifications. Sip your favorite beverage.
Wear your beginnerâs hat. Go with the flow. Welcome the stumbles and fumbles. Congratulate yourself for trying. Keep going!Â
Our hosts are members of the CreativeMornings communityâjust like you! Everyone comes to this with different backgroundsâa lot of our hosts have never done anything like this before! And we love that! Cheer them on when something goes awry and when it goes perfectly.
Weâre all figuring things out in real time. Celebrate, rather than critique emerging ideas. Cheer each other on as you try new things. Try âYes! AndâŚâ in conversation.
Itâs 100% okay when a FieldTrip does not resonate with you. Pop out quietly and try another experience later. Fill out the survey with your feedback (no dms to host or chat commentary, please.)
